Komodo National Park

Just a short journey from Jurassic Park Island Flores, Komodo National Park is one of Indonesia’s most famous attractions. Known worldwide for the Komodo dragons, the park is a must-visit for wildlife enthusiasts and adventure travelers. In addition to seeing these ancient reptiles, visitors can enjoy snorkeling, diving, and trekking across the islands, all while surrounded by stunning tropical landscapes.


The proximity of Komodo National Park makes it easy to include a day trip or multi-day tour alongside your visit to Nuca Molas. Many tours depart from Labuan Bajo, offering combined itineraries that cover both the prehistoric landscapes of Jurassic Park Island Flores and the unique wildlife of Komodo.



Pink Beach (Pantai Merah)

Another spectacular nearby attraction is Pink Beach, also known as Pantai Merah. Its distinctive pink sand, created by tiny red coral fragments mixed with white sand, provides a unique and picture-perfect destination for travelers. Visitors can swim, snorkel, and relax while enjoying the vibrant colors of the beach and surrounding coral reefs.


Pink Beach is often paired with trips to Komodo National Park and Nuca Molas, creating a well-rounded itinerary that combines adventure, wildlife, and relaxation. This makes Flores an ideal destination for travelers looking for diverse natural experiences in a single trip.



Flores Villages and Cultural Experiences

Flores is not just about natural beauty; it also offers rich cultural experiences. Near Nuca Molas, travelers can explore traditional Flores villages, where locals preserve age-old customs, crafts, and lifestyles.


Visitors can tour traditional houses, participate in local ceremonies, and interact with the friendly communities. These cultural encounters provide a deeper understanding of Flores heritage and complement the adventure of exploring Jurassic Park Island Flores.

Tips for Visiting Nearby Attractions

  1. Plan ahead: Some attractions require guided tours or permits, especially Komodo National Park.
  2. Combine trips: Many tour operators offer multi-destination packages, including Nuca Molas, Komodo National Park, and Pink Beach.
  3. Bring essentials: Water, snacks, sun protection, and sturdy shoes are necessary for trekking and beach activities.
  4. Respect local culture and environment: When visiting villages or natural sites, follow local customs and avoid disturbing wildlife.
